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
193 247858 6040 5175136
31543875036 297 91663
31543875036 297 91663
3591425 344671 7421
All about undefined
Interested in learning more?
31543875036 297 91663
3591425 344671 7421
See more
5947 263218352
107406 33 5553078433
See more
59474 20837926
00112 578 552234 3194 96678
See more